Citigroup: Total Circulating Supply of Stablecoins Could Reach $1.6-3.7 Trillion by 2030

By: theblockbeats.news|2025/07/14 12:16:59

BlockBeats News, July 14th, according to ledgerinsights, Citibank predicted that by 2030, the total circulation supply of stablecoins could grow to between $16 trillion and $37 trillion under different scenarios. It is expected that stablecoin supply will still be primarily denominated in USD (around 90%), while non-US countries will drive the development of their own CBDCs.
